  • Haj pilgrims can carry Zamzam water within permissible baggage allowance: Air India

    Published on July 9, 2019

    Air India has said that pilgrims returning from Saudi Arabia after Haj will be allowed to carry holy water from the Zamzam within permissible baggage allowance.

    The well of Zamzam is located in Mecca in Saudi Arabia and many Haj pilgrims bring the holy water from the well for family and friends.

    On July 4, the sales team of Air India’s Jeddah office reportedly wrote to all travel agents stating that till September 15, due to change of aircraft and limitation of seats, Zamzam cans will not be allowed on some flights.

    Air India clarified in a tweet today that passengers are allowed to carry Zamzam cans within their permissible baggage allowance. The airline further apologised for the inconvenience.
